We have managed to find many small family firms still hand making textiles in Turkey and Syria which we are delighted to show here. Each piece is handloomed, hand made or hand embroidered, or all three! The hand of the maker is still present in textiles such as these which add to their beauty and charm. Our Syrian suppliers, despite the troubles the country faces, are still using the looms their ancestors have worked on for the last 150 years and we are still able to order from them.
Our cushions are from a variety of sources, most using traditionally woven and loomed silk, cotton or velvet textiles particularly from Uzbekistan. Our rug cushions are made from salvaged antique rug fragments or fine knotted wool tribal bags.
